> Kafka *dataproc* sink is very useful to subscribe from Kafka topic into Google cloud Dataproc (Apache spark).
> *Dataproc* is a fast[, easy-to-use, ful|https://cloud.google.com/dataproc/docs]ly managed cloud service for running Apache Spark and Apache Hadoop clusters in a simpler, more cost-efficient way.
